PLANTAE / PHANEROGAMAE / ANTHOPHYTA / SOLANALES / CONVOLVULACEAE / IPOMOEEAE / IPOMOEA / ALBA
Herbaceous annual or perennial, usually glabrous. Stems prostrate or twining, laticiferous, smooth or sometimes muriculate, up to 5 m long. Leaves oblong to orbicular in outline, 60-120 x 50-160 mm, entire or 3-lobed, apex acuminate, mucronulate, base cordate, basal auricles rounded to angular, margin entire; petiole 50-200 mm long. Inflorescence axillary, 1-several-flowered; peduncle stout, 10-240 mm long; bracteoles small; pedicels up to 30 mm long and very thick in fruit. Sepals unequal, elliptic; outer ones 5-10 mm long with a long awn-like appendage; inner ones 8-15 mm long, shortly mucronulate. Corolla salver-shaped, opening at night, fragrant, white, greenish cream-coloured below; tube 70-150 mm long, cylindrical; limb 110-160 mm wide. Capsule ovoid, mucronate, glabrous, 25-30 mm long. Seeds 4, ovoid, 10-12 mm long, white, brown or black, glabrous, smooth. Flowering time throughout the year, mostly January and February. From: Meeuse, ADJ; Welman, WG. 2000. Convolvulaceae. Fl. S. Twining or prostrate annual or perennial herb. Leaves ovate or circular in outline, entire or 3-lobed. Inflorescence 1-several-flowered. Sepals distinctly awned. Corolla tube 70-120 mm long. Seeds glabrous. Flowers white or greenish cream below, opening at night. From: Retief, E; Herman, PPJ. 1997. Plants of the northern provinces of South Africa: Keys and diagnostic characters. Found in grassland, on river banks, along roadsides and in waste places. From: Meeuse, ADJ; Welman, WG. 2000. Convolvulaceae. Fl. S. Africa 28(1): 1-138. National Botanical Institute, Pretoria. [http://www.biodiversitylibrary.org/item/209568#page/1/mode/1up] [CC BY]
Grassland, riverbanks, waste places and roadsides. From: Retief, E; Herman, PPJ. 1997. Plants of the northern provinces of South Africa: Keys and diagnostic characters. Strelitzia 6: 1-681. National Botanical Institute, Pretoria. [CC BY]
Probably originally tropical American. In southern Africa it has spread in Mpumalanga and the coastal areas of Kwazulu-Natal and the Eastern Cape. From: Meeuse, ADJ; Welman, WG. 2000. Convolvulaceae.
